The following error is displayed in the ../primekit/logs/ssp/ssp_daily.log when a user requests an RSA SecurID Software Token for Microsoft Windows through the RSA SecurID Access Prime Self-Service Console:
2020-04-22T14:52:49,922-0400,com.rsa.pso.selfservice.web.SSPHomeActionBean,51,INFO ,Request for new Token {"TT":"software","DT":"Desktop PC#5.x","SHIP":"undefined","PIN":"******","QRCode":true,"emaildId":"null","distpwd"******""}
2020-04-22T14:53:01,597-0400,com.rsa.pso.selfservice.web.SSPHomeActionBean,51,INFO ,requestNewSoftwareToken() devicetype Desktop PC#5.x
2020-04-22T14:53:01,598-0400,com.rsa.pso.selfservice.web.SSPHomeActionBean,51,INFO ,DistributionType for Desktop PC#5.x: CTKIP_QRENABLED
.
.
2020-04-22T14:53:07,923-0400,com.rsa.pso.services.NotificationServiceHelper,51,INFO ,FAILURE_LOG[$Thread: 25
com.rsa.pso.services.ServiceException: Device not available
STACK_TRACE[$com.rsa.pso.services.ServiceException: Device not available
com.rsa.pso.services.NotificationServiceHelper.distributeTokenCTKIPQRCode(Unknown Source)
The /opt/rsa/primekit/configs/ssp/config/device.xml file has the Desktop PC property name pointing to Desktop PC 5.x, but the RSA Authentication Manager server has only Desktop PC 4.x:
<bean class="com.rsa.pso.selfservice.securid.MobileDevice" parent="defaultMobileDevice">
<property name="deviceFamilyName" value="Desktop PC" />
<property name="versionNumber" value="5.x" />
<property name="deviceManager" ref="blankDeviceManagerBean" />
<property name="distributionType" ref="CTKIP_DISPLAY" />
</bean>
<property name="versionNumber" value="4.x" />
cd /opt/rsa/primekit/scripts
./ ssp_shutdown.sh
,/ssp_startup.sh